<br/>In order to keep your outside condenser fan running efficiently, make sure the coils and the fan blades are cleaned before the cooling season begins. If you are doing more than a light surface cleaning, make sure that the power is shut off to the HVAC unit. Remove leaves and debris from the outside condenser.
<br/>
<br/>If the condenser for your HVAC system is located outside, make sure you clear away any debris that might settle in or around it. Wind can pile up all sorts of debris against its grill. This can lead to overheating.
<br/>
<br/>The coils and blades on the fans should be cleaned once a year. Start by turning off the power to avoid having anything move when you work on it. Take the grill off and pull the blades out to clean them.
<br/>
<br/>Lubricate your fan condenser at least once a year. You'll find these ports are covered with a metal or rubber cap. Chose SAE 20 oil, which has been proven to be the most effective.
<br/>
<br/>When you are choosing a location for the outdoor compressor unit, it's preferable to use a shaded area. The unit will operate more efficiently to cool your home if the intake air is cooler to begin with.
<br/>
<br/>It is very important that your HVAC system is serviced two times a year. The best times to have the system checked is spring and fall, so you are sure everything is running at peak performance before the heating and cooling seasons. Even if you don't notice anything wrong, you can check it out to figure out what the potential issues are.
<br/>
<br/>Condenser units for the outdoors should be shut off when it starts to get cold outside. Avoid damaging the unit by turning it off when the outdoor temperature drops below 60 degrees. Doing this keeps your system working well for years and saves you from having to spend money to repair it.
<br/>
<br/>A programmable thermostat is a simple way to help save money on air conditioning costs. In fact, you can save as much as 10 percent on both heating and cooling when you turn your thermostat by by 10-15 percent for at least 8 hours daily. Also, you can find a thermostat that is controllable from a computer or smart phone.
<br/>
<br/>If nobody is home, turn off the air conditioner to save money. When you turn the air conditioner off, the house may heat up a little but only a certain amount. If will be constantly fighting the heat and using lots of electricity if it is left on all day.
